Climate Overview

The climate in Dompu is hot. The average annual temperature is 26°C and approximately 1648mm of precipitation falls per year. February is the wettest month, receiving around 322mm of rainfall. Dompu sits near the equator, so seasonal temperature differences are minimal throughout the year.

Dompu has relatively stable temperatures year-round, staying within a 9°C range. The warmest month is November, when average highs reach 31°C and the mean temperature sits around 27°C. August is the coolest month, with minimum temperatures around 22°C and an average of 25°C. Daily temperature variation is modest, with an average difference of 6°C between highs and lows.

Dompu is a fairly wet location, receiving approximately 1648mm of precipitation annually, which averages out to around 137mm per month. The wettest month is February, averaging 322mm of rainfall. January and March also tend to see above-average precipitation. The driest month is August, with just 8mm. That's 313mm less than February, the wettest month. Rainfall is heavily concentrated in certain months, creating a distinct wet and dry season. Visitors should plan around these patterns, as the difference between peak and low months is dramatic.
